OS: NixOS config Compositor: Niri 25.11 (Nixpkgs)

Problem: Steam opens normally when no recent clipboard activity. After copying text from any app (Firefox, terminal, etc.), Steam hangs silently and won’t launch until:

  1. I run wl-copy --clear, or
  2. Close the app that owns the clipboard

Logs: This is the logs of launching steam after i have copied some text from any app.

steam
steam.sh[13923]: Running Steam on nixos 25.11 64-bit
steam.sh[13923]: STEAM_RUNTIME is enabled automatically
setup.sh[13979]: Steam runtime environment up-to-date!
steam.sh[13923]: Log already open
steam.sh[13923]: Steam client's requirements are satisfied
CProcessEnvironmentManager is ready, 6 preallocated environment variables.
[2026-01-23 17:24:09] Startup - updater built Jan 21 2026 17:12:15
[2026-01-23 17:24:09] Startup - Steam Client launched with: '/home/yashraj/.local/share/Steam/ubuntu12_32/steam' '-srt-logger-opened'
01/23 17:24:09 minidumps folder is set to /tmp/dumps
01/23 17:24:09 Init: Installing breakpad exception handler for appid(steam)/version(1769025840)/tid(14021)
Looks like steam didn't shutdown cleanly, scheduling immediate update check
CProcessEnvironmentManager is ready, 6 preallocated environment variables.
[2026-01-23 17:24:09] Process started with command-line: '/home/yashraj/.local/share/Steam/ubuntu12_32/steam' '-child-update-ui' '-child-update-ui-socket' '8' '-srt-logger-opened'
01/23 17:24:09 minidumps folder is set to /tmp/dumps
[2026-01-23 17:24:09] Using update UI: xwin
01/23 17:24:09 Init: Installing breakpad exception handler for appid(steam)/version(0)/tid(14022)
[2026-01-23 17:24:09] Create window
[2026-01-23 17:24:09] Loading cached metrics from disk (/home/yashraj/.local/share/Steam/package/steam_client_metrics.bin)
[2026-01-23 17:24:09] Using the following download hosts for Public, Realm steamglobal
[2026-01-23 17:24:09] 1. https://client-update.fastly.steamstatic.com/, /, Realm 'steamglobal', weight was 900, source = 'update_hosts_cached.vdf'
[2026-01-23 17:24:09] 2. https://client-update.akamai.steamstatic.com/, /, Realm 'steamglobal', weight was 400, source = 'update_hosts_cached.vdf'
[2026-01-23 17:24:09] 3. https://client-update.steamstatic.com/, /, Realm 'steamglobal', weight was 1, source = 'baked in'
[2026-01-23 17:24:09] Checking for update on startup
[2026-01-23 17:24:09] Checking for available updates...
[2026-01-23 17:24:09] Downloading manifest: https://client-update.fastly.steamstatic.com/steam_client_ubuntu12
[2026-01-23 17:24:09] Manifest download: send request
[2026-01-23 17:24:09] Set percent complete: 0
[2026-01-23 17:24:09] Set status message: Checking for available updates...
[2026-01-23 17:24:09] Set percent complete: -1
[2026-01-23 17:24:09] Manifest download: waiting for download to finish
[2026-01-23 17:24:11] Show window
[2026-01-23 17:24:14] Manifest download: finished
[2026-01-23 17:24:14] Download skipped: /steam_client_ubuntu12 version 1769025840, installed version 1769025840, existing pending version 0
[2026-01-23 17:24:14] Nothing to do
[2026-01-23 17:24:14] Verifying installation...
[2026-01-23 17:24:14] Verifying all executable checksums
[2026-01-23 17:24:14] Set percent complete: -1
[2026-01-23 17:24:14] Set status message: Verifying installation...
[2026-01-23 17:24:14] Verification complete
UpdateUI: skip show logo
[2026-01-23 17:24:14] Destroy window

Steam logging initialized: directory: /home/yashraj/.local/share/Steam/logs

[2026-01-23 17:24:14] Shutdown
XRRGetOutputInfo Workaround: initialized with override: 0 real: 0xf615c830
XRRGetCrtcInfo Workaround: initialized with override: 0 real: 0xf615b000
01/23 17:24:16 minidumps folder is set to /tmp/dumps
01/23 17:24:16 Init: Installing breakpad exception handler for appid(steamsysinfo)/version(1769025840)/tid(14061)
Running query: 1 - GpuTopology
Response: gpu_topology {
  gpus {
    id: 1
    name: "Intel(R) Graphics (RPL-S)"
    vram_size_bytes: 12263648256
    driver_id: k_EGpuDriverId_MesaIntel
    driver_version_major: 25
    driver_version_minor: 2
    driver_version_patch: 6
    luid: 0
  }
  gpus {
    id: 2
    name: "NVIDIA GeForce RTX 5050 Laptop GPU"
    vram_size_bytes: 8546942976
    driver_id: k_EGpuDriverId_NvidiaProprietary
    driver_version_major: 580
    driver_version_minor: 119
    driver_version_patch: 2
    luid: 0
  }
  gpus {
    id: 3
    name: "NVIDIA GeForce RTX 5050 Laptop GPU"
    vram_size_bytes: 8546942976
    driver_id: k_EGpuDriverId_NvidiaProprietary
    driver_version_major: 580
    driver_version_minor: 119
    driver_version_patch: 2
    luid: 0
  }
  gpus {
    id: 4
    name: "Intel(R) Graphics (RPL-S)"
    vram_size_bytes: 12263648256
    driver_id: k_EGpuDriverId_MesaIntel
    driver_version_major: 25
    driver_version_minor: 2
    driver_version_patch: 6
    luid: 0
  }
  gpus {
    id: 5
    name: "llvmpipe (LLVM 21.1.7, 256 bits)"
    vram_size_bytes: 3221225472
    driver_id: k_EGpuDriverId_MesaLLVMPipe
    driver_version_major: 25
    driver_version_minor: 2
    driver_version_patch: 6
    luid: 0
  }
  gpus {
    id: 6
    name: "llvmpipe (LLVM 21.1.7, 256 bits)"
    vram_size_bytes: 3221225472
    driver_id: k_EGpuDriverId_MesaLLVMPipe
    driver_version_major: 25
    driver_version_minor: 2
    driver_version_patch: 6
    luid: 0
  }
  default_gpu_id: 1
}

Exit code: 0